Understanding the Ipswich Property Market Before You Sell
The Ipswich property market is not one single story.
Ripley and newer estates often attract first-home buyers and young families.Eastern Heights and Woodend draw buyers looking for character homes.Brassall and Raceview regularly attract investors focused on rental returns.
Each area behaves differently.
For example:
First-home buyers focus on affordability and functionality.
Families prioritise school zones and yard space.
Investors look at rental demand and long-term growth.
A knowledgeable Ipswich real estate agency explains these differences and helps you position your property correctly, aligned with local planning insights from the Ipswich City Council.
Understanding who your likely buyer is changes everything, from effective presentation strategy to pricing and negotiation approach.
When you understand how your specific suburb is performing within the broader Ipswich property market, you avoid guesswork and make informed decisions from the start.
Questions to Ask Before Hiring a Real Estate Agent in Ipswich
Before signing with any Ipswich real estate agency, ask direct questions.
What have you sold recently in my suburb?
Street-level knowledge matters.
How did you determine my price range?
They should reference recent comparable sales.
What will happen in the first two weeks of my campaign?
Early momentum is critical.
How will you generate buyer competition?
This reveals their negotiation strategy.
How often will you update me?
Consistency shows professionalism.
Experienced agents answer confidently and specifically. You can also verify that your chosen agent is properly licensed through the Queensland Office of Fair Trading.

Common Mistakes Sellers Make When Choosing a Real Estate Agent in Ipswich
We see these patterns regularly.
Choosing the Highest Appraisal
Some agents quote high to secure the listing.
Weeks later, price reductions follow. Buyers lose confidence.
Realistic pricing creates competition early.
Choosing Based on Lowest Commission
An agent who negotiates strongly often secures far more than any small fee difference.
Assuming All Marketing Is Equal
Professional photography, targeted online placement, and clear messaging influence buyer behaviour directly.
Presentation shapes perception.
Not Discussing Negotiation Strategy
Marketing gets buyers through the door. Negotiation determines the final figure.
Ask how multiple offers are handled. Ask how conditional contracts are managed.
Professional structure protects your result.
